The Gumbo Limbo Environmental Complex, also known as the Gumbo Limbo Nature Center, is a nature center located in Boca Raton, Florida. It is operated by the city of Boca Raton in conjunction with the Gumbo Limbo Coastal Stewards and the Greater Boca Raton Beach and Park District. The center is situated on twenty acres of protected barrier island, between the Intracoastal Waterway and the Atlantic Ocean.

Facilities at the Gumbo Limbo Nature Center

The Gumbo Limbo Nature Center offers a variety of attractions for visitors. Inside, there is a museum with exhibits and small aquariums, as well as a gift shop. Outside, the center features several large aquariums that showcase ecosystems for fish, turtles, and other sea life. There is also a boardwalk trail through the adjacent woods and a garden designed for observing butterflies.

Sea Turtle Conservation at Gumbo Limbo

Gumbo Limbo Nature Center is renowned for its efforts in protecting the area's sea turtles. The beaches of South Florida, where the center is located, serve as a nesting habitat for the loggerhead, green, and leatherback sea turtles. The center collaborates with the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ission to safeguard these sea turtles.
